Morale: First Line of Defense? is a book written by Edward L. Bernays, which explores the importance of morale in times of crisis. The author argues that morale is the foundation of a strong defense, and that it is essential for individuals and communities to maintain a positive outlook during difficult times. The book covers a range of topics related to morale, including the psychological factors that influence it, the impact of leadership on morale, and strategies for boosting morale in times of crisis. Drawing on his extensive experience in public relations and propaganda, Bernays provides practical advice for individuals and organizations looking to improve their morale and strengthen their defenses. Overall, Morale: First Line of Defense? is a thought-provoking and insightful book that offers valuable insights into the role of morale in times of crisis.This is a new release of the original 1941 edition.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
